Abstract
A találmány tárgya katalizátor aktivátorként alkalmazható vegyület,amelyet a következő általános képlettel írnak le: (A *+a)b(Z*J*j)-cd aképletben A* jelentése egy kation, amelynek a töltése +a és jelentéseammónium, szulfonium, foszfonium, oxonium, karbonium, szililium,ferrocénium, Ag2+ vagy Pb2+, Z* jelentése egy anion, amely 1-50,előnyösen 1-30 atomot tartalmaz, nem számítva a hidrogénatomokat éstartalmaz még kettő vagy több Lewis-bázis helyet, J* jelentéseegymástól függetlenül egy Lewis sav, amely legalább egy Z* Lewis bázishelyhez koordinálódik, és adott esetben két vagy több J* csoport összeis kapcsolódhat és ez a rész több Lewis savas funkciót tartalmaz, jértéke 2-12 közötti szám, és a, b, c és d értéke 1-3 azzal amegkötéssel, hogy a x b egyenlő c x d-ve1. A találmány vonatkoziktovábbá egy katalizátor készítményre, amely kokatalizátoraktivátorként a találmány szerinti fenti vegyületet tartalmazza,továbbá vonatkozik ezen katalizátor készítmény jelenlétében végzettpolimerizációs eljárásra is.
